Ami Colé Is Closing, but Its Impact on Beauty and Representation Lives On

In 2021, after noticing the continued lack of inclusivity in beauty, Diarrha N’Diaye-Mbaye launched Ami Colé, a clean beauty brand inspired by her Senegalese roots and Harlem upbringing, made specifically for melanin-rich skin. Last week, Diarrha announced that after four years, Ami Colé will officially close in September.

Former Little League Star Mo’ne Davis to Compete in Women’s Pro Baseball Tryouts

At just 13 years old, Mo’ne Davis broke barriers pitching in the 2014 Little League World Series, becoming the first girl to win a game and throw a shutout in the competition. Now, at 24, Davis is stepping up once again. She will be among hundreds of players trying out for the Women’s Professional Baseball League in Washington, D.C. later this month.
